What to expect during your studies

Expect a blend of interactive lectures, group projects, and practical sessions that mirror real learning environments. Courses emphasize observation based assessment, lesson planning, and reflective practice. You’ll engage with peers through collaborative tasks and receive feedback from teachers who bring current local policy and industry insights into the classroom. When you complete assignments, you’ll document growth in each student, preparing you for robust professional portfolios that demonstrate your readiness for the workforce in Melbourne and beyond.

Financial and timing considerations

Planning your finances and scheduling your studies carefully helps you stay on track. Explore options such as government funded training, scholarships, or employer reimbursement programs if available in your area. Many Melbourne providers offer streamlined timelines, offering accelerated tracks or evening classes to accommodate working adults. Budgeting for textbooks, resources, and placement fees is part of the process, but the long term payoff includes stronger employment prospects, improved job security, and a clear pathway into roles that support children during their crucial early years.
